summ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Alberto Planas <aplanas@gmail.com>2022-08-03 16:36:04 +0200
committerMariusz Felisiak <felisiak.mariusz@gmail.com>2022-08-03 16:36:48 +0200
commit9e9bdf8dbd6e2354a2e23aa7e37d5b491338085e (patch)
tree0b73d3f81e642ab234c043336473c81e72be4f8a
parenta9268e3225e1025b45bd59a26af5c2ba24fd4941 (diff)
[4.1.x] Fixed #33887 -- Fixed test_fails_squash_migration_manual_porting() on final tags.
Regression in 7c318a8bdd66f8c5241864c9970dddb525d0ca4c. Backport of 4e13b40a764cfdae50416338c5d077e9d9a6d0f1 from main
-rw-r--r--tests/migrations/test_commands.py9
1 files changed, 5 insertions, 4 deletions
diff --git a/tests/migrations/test_commands.py b/tests/migrations/test_commands.py
index a3e1efc924..0d4fb52bbb 100644
--- a/tests/migrations/test_commands.py
+++ b/tests/migrations/test_commands.py
@@ -3005,11 +3005,12 @@ class OptimizeMigrationTests(MigrationTestBase):
with self.temporary_migration_module(
module="migrations.test_migrations_manual_porting"
) as migration_dir:
+ version = get_docs_version()
msg = (
- "Migration will require manual porting but is already a squashed "
- "migration.\nTransition to a normal migration first: "
- "https://docs.djangoproject.com/en/dev/topics/migrations/"
- "#squashing-migrations"
+ f"Migration will require manual porting but is already a squashed "
+ f"migration.\nTransition to a normal migration first: "
+ f"https://docs.djangoproject.com/en/{version}/topics/migrations/"
+ f"#squashing-migrations"
)
with self.assertRaisesMessage(CommandError, msg):
call_command("optimizemigration", "migrations", "0004", stdout=out)